kcalTutti Frutti is a colourful confection containing dried candied Papaya.

Ingredients
3 1/2cup All Purpose Flour
2tsp Instant Yeast
1tbsp Sugar
1tsp Salt
1cup Warm Milk
2 Eggs , slightly beaten
2tbsp Butter , room temperature
1 cup Tutti Frutti
Pinch of Saffron , optional
Directions
- Mix together Flour , Yeast , Sugar , Salt & Butter .
- Carefully add Saffron infused Milk & Egg .
- Mix everything well .
- If Your dough is sticky add more Flour .
- Knead the dough until You have a soft dough .
- Add Tutti Frutti into dough & mix everything well .
- Take the dough out from the mixer & knead for a bit .
- Cover & leave the dough for an hour , until its doubled in size , in a well oiled bowl .
- Once its doubled , knead again & divide into 2 equal parts .
- Knead each dough separately & shape into a loaf .
- Place the dough inside a greased loaf pan .
Let the dough rise again till it reaches the rim , about 40min . - Bake in a 325degree pre-heated Oven for about 30-35min or until the top is golden brown & bread sounds hollow when tapped at the bottom .
- Brush some Butter on top of the warm Bread .
- Let it cool down completely before slicing .
- Serve it with Jam or Butter .
Notes
- For kneading I used my Kitchenaid Stand mixer . If You don’t have a stand mixer its always good to use Your hands .
If You are using Saffron try to soak it in the Warm Milk for about 5min .
Always try to keep extra Flour , when You knead the dough You may need more .
